This giant Yorkshire pudding recipe makes the perfect show-stopping vessel for your roast dinner. Get the perfect result every time by following our Yorkshire pudding recipe and let us know how you get on.
Preheat the oven to 220ºC/gas mark 7. Add 2 tsp oil to each of 4 x 18½cm sandwich cake tins and put them in the oven to heat up.
Meanwhile, sift the flour into a large bowl and make a well in the centre. Beat in the eggs until smooth, then gradually add the milk, beating until the mixture is smooth and free of lumps.
Pour the batter into a jug. Remove the hot cake tins from the oven and carefully pour a quarter of the batter into each tin. Bake for 20 minutes, or until the puddings are well risen and golden in colour.
Fill the Yorkshires with your roast dinner and gravy, and serve immediately.
